ML Utterances Export API¶
To export the ML utterances of a bot by creating a request ID to generate the download link of the bot using the ML Utterance Export Status API.
Method | POST |
Endpoint | https://{{host}}/api/public/bot/{{BotID}}/mlexport
|
Content Type | application/json
|
Authorization | auth: {{JWT}}
|
API Scope |
|
Query Parameters¶
PARAMETER | DESCRIPTION | MANDATE |
host | The environment URL. For example, https://bots.kore.ai
|
Required |
BotId | Bot ID or Stream ID can be accessed under General Settings on the Bot Builder. | Required |
Sample Request¶
curl -X POST 'https://{{host}}/api/public/bot/{{bot_id}}/mlexport?state=configured&=&type=csv' \
-H 'auth: {{YOUR_JWT_ACCESS_TOKEN}}' \
-H 'content-type: application/json'
Body Parameters¶
No body parameters are passed.
Sample Response¶
{
"status": "IN_PROGRESS",
"percentageComplete": 0,
"streamId": "st-22184e1f-e116-5ed4-8741-7aec3be466d7",
"jobType": "ML_UTTERANCE",
"action": "EXPORT",
"countOfDockStatuses": 1,
"createdBy": "u-8214dc3a-c749-5d23-b8ad-2a21bfa396ca",
"fileType": "CSV",
"statusLogs": [],
"_id": "ds-db32ec69-7f80-5873-890a-576fe585965f",
"lMod": "2023-07-26T13:15:04.000Z",
"createdOn": "2023-07-26T13:15:04.983Z",
"requestedTime": "2023-07-26T13:15:04.984Z",
"__v": 0
}